
Self Love | Mental Health | Taboo Topics Hello, my name is Drue Lee and welcome to Yours Druelee Podcast. On this podcast, you'll get an incite of my real, raw, and truth of my experience as a Hmong American woman who has been married, divorced, and now reliving my life as a single woman.
